New Delhi : The legendary football player of the world, Cristiano Ronaldo, who ruled the football world for the past decade, shared his early struggles in his life in an interview. Ronaldo has made several records so far in his career. He is counted among the richest players in the world. Seeing the lifestyle he lives today, it is hard to guess that McDonald's leftover beggars have been begging for food once upon a time. Cristiano Ronaldo said in an interview that when he was 12 years old, he lived in Lisbon when he had no money.

At night, when he was hungry, he used to go to a McDonald's outlet nearby. Ronaldo said that he used to go to Macdonald's back kitchen and ask if the burgers were left. Then three girls working there used to give him the remaining burgers. One of them was named Adena. Ronaldo said that he has been looking for those girls for a long time but he has not been able to meet them till date. He tried to meet those girls in Portugal but he could not succeed. Ronaldo said that with the help of this interview, he wants to find those girls so that he can call them to his house and thank them while having dinner with them.
